How
to Keep Your Body Fit
|
|
by: Alex
Fir
|
Fitness
is just as imperative as health. As a matter of
fact, fitness is linked directly with your health.
If you are not taking care of your body, you will
get sick. Here are some great suggestions that
will help you to keep your body fit:
1. Bicycling
It is a sad thing that many people do not take
advantage of this excellent option for exercise.
Bike riding exercise your body and build a
stronger cardiovascular system. Also, it allows
you to get out and enjoy nature and fresh air.
2. Jogging or Walking
Both jogging and walking are wonderful ways to get
fit. They tone the muscles, relieve stress, create
a healthier heart, and improve lung capability.
3. Swimming
Swimming is an exceptional way to get into and
stay in shape. Swimming will help you tighten your
body, lose weight, and get a good overall workout.
4. Tennis
Tennis is a great way to exercise. Just running
after the ball alone will help get you into shape.
This is a great way to strengthen your
cardiovascular system and lose weight.
5. Dancing
Dancing is so much fun and as long as you are
moving, it really does not matter what type of
dance or music. The whole idea is to move your
body. Dancing has long been recommended as an
avenue to fitness.
6. VCR
If you have a VCR or DVD, try sticking in some
good workout tapes. Even taking 15 minutes every
day to workout will get you started. Try that for
two weeks and you will be surprised at the
results.
7. Abdominal Crunches
Crunches have long been a favorite for many
athletes for the very reason that they work. Lying
on your back with knees bent, keeping feet flat on
the floor, cross your hands across your chest and
then curl your torso, rolling from your sternum
toward your hips. Do this slowly and start out
with a set of ten crunches in three reps. As you
get accustomed to these, you can increase both the
number of sets and reps.
8. Squats
Squats are excellent for glutes, hamstrings,
quads, and calves. With your feet standing firm
and spread apart about two feet, bend your knees
slightly. Then, very smoothly, you will squat
toward the floor without going all the way down.
9. Tricep Press
For an Overhead Tricep Press, standing on the
floor with your feet about two feet apart, knees
slightly bent, you will extend your arms over your
head. Keep your elbows locked and then very slowly
lower your hands behind your head. You want to do
this with some type of weight, but small weights
like one to five pounds.
